CSE Crosscom is a leading supplier and integrator of two-way radio and telecommunications products, infrastructure and services. We work with major industrial, government, transport, mining, resources, and utilities across Australia and New Zealand.

With this opportunity as the Technical Services Manager, you will manage and lead an established team of technician's working in both the CSE workshop and clients onsite. You will be hands on in creating and establishing work patterns and best practice service methods focusing on client satisfaction and customer service, while ensuring that your team is working efficiently, effectively and developing their skills as we evolve as a business. You will have strong business acumen and give direction to how the Service Team operates, covering financial elements, HSEQ, SLA's & KPI's, governance and compliance, and continuous improvement, while being a key member of the Singleton branch management team sharing your insights.

Responsibilities will include:

  • Foster teamwork, and facilitating a positive environment (Toolbox talks, performance reviews, coaching, and identify training opportunities).
  • Work in hand with Operations for all scheduling and solutions deliveries
  • Manage utilisation of employees and resources for service delivery
  • Take ownership of maintenance, including managing completion of maintenance and customer technical records ensuring compliance to contracted requirements and licence agreements.
  • Manage and report on Technical Services operating costs
  • Oversee vendor quality, ensuring all manufactured products meet the requirements and technical specifications needed.
  • Be proactive in HSEQ, from reporting, compliance and improvement of processes.
  • Ensure governance to CSE policies and procedures
  • Actively seek continuous improvement opportunities
  • Work with clients to ensure customer satisfaction

What we are looking for:

  • Proven experience in a Service Management role, overseeing end to end from people management, cost management, customer service and reporting
  • Formal and hands on leadership experience, with a medium to large team in a technical setting
  • Exposure to contract development and management
  • Tertiary qualifications, Trades Certification or applied experience in a technical field.
  • Excellent communication, both written and verbal with an elevated level of attention to detail.
  • A proven track record in leadership, with a history of developing and growing a cohesive service orientated team.
  • Strong ability to identify and action areas of improvement
  • An analytical and strategic thinker
  • Excellent financial acumen with previous experience in understanding financial aspects of a service-based business.
  • A collaborative and positive attitude, with a willingness to adopt and promote CSE values both internally and to clients.
